feat: Refactor session management UI and enhance accessibility features

This commit is contained in:
Andre Beging
2025-10-07 15:33:45 +02:00
parent ddf29c1d36
commit f3b30d46c9
3 changed files with 85 additions and 23 deletions

View File

@@ -73,11 +73,28 @@ main {
justify-content: center;
align-items: center;
gap: 1rem;
flex-wrap: wrap;
}
.helper-button {
min-width: 14rem;
font-weight: 600;
display: inline-flex;
align-items: center;
justify-content: center;
gap: 0.45rem;
}
.session-card-toggle-status {
display: inline-flex;
align-items: center;
font-weight: 600;
line-height: 1.1;
}
.session-card-toggle-text {
font-weight: 500;
color: var(--muted);
}
.card {
@@ -143,8 +160,7 @@ main {
}
.session-toggle {
align-self: center;
white-space: nowrap;
align-self: flex-start;
}
.session-details {